“Olden”

Words often used, never to grow tiresome,
Pages spread in an open book,
Works yellowed with age,
Smiles that never lose that sparkle,
Longing for the refreshments of years ago,
Memories of children games, laughter abound,
Songs, tunes and melodies flutter around,
Pictures, photo’s on the wall, long ago dusty,
The soft scent of blossoms in far off corners,
Flavours of comfort food, swirl across taste buds,
Tattered teddy bears, in the corner of the room,
Moon-kissed dream-catchers, sway in the windless air,
Sunlight streaming through faded curtains,
Magnets on the purring fridge door,
Postcards of travels gone by,
Coloured pencils, sharpened to a stub,
Tears stains on a sun kissed face,
Nose prints on the cracked window,
Hearing the voice of someone gone,
These are moments never old, never gone,
Thank thee for the old and new,
For changes hurts less for some,
Olden of spirit, yet full of youth.
Olden we have become, only in body, not inside.
Olden memories to keep, till next, we meet.
